  4. That sounds great! I know so10 has requested (through TRAC) that we have something in the admin to choose themes. Here is what I have been doing for mine!

    /my-templates/theme1/
    /my-templates/theme2/
    /my-templates/theme3/

    Then I just have to copy contents of the theme folder I want to use to the root of /my-templates/

    It is a pain right now, but really simple when using FTP I guess!
